Bug description:
  SRU: backport python 3.5.2 to 16.04 LTS

  The idea is to ship a released version with the first point release of
  16.04 LTS. We updated python3.5 from the the 3.5 branch up to the
  final 3.5.2 release, and then made a test rebuild of the archive using
  the new python3.5 (and some other toolchain packages).

  The test rebuild was done using the release candidate of 3.5.2,
  however the only changes between the rc and the final release are
  Windows related, and include one change in the idle lib, plus a fix
  for a ssl test case which was already present as a local patch in the
  Ubuntu package. From my point of view we don't need another test
  rebuild.

  The evaluation of the test rebuild is found in LP: #1586673. There are
  some issues found and/or left:

   - nuitka (a python compiler) fails in the tests, fixed by updating
     to the nuitka version in yakkety, tracked in LP: #1599240.

   - python-websockets fail in the tests. This is now
     https://bugs.debian.org/829726 and
     https://github.com/aaugustin/websockets/issues/123
     From my point of view this looks like an issue with the test case.

   - urwid fails two tests on ppc64el and s390x.
